One of the most common misconceptions about funerals is that they are always somber and depressing affairs. While grief is a natural part of the process, funerals can also be celebratory events that focus on the life and legacy of the deceased. Many families personalize the service with uplifting music, anecdotes, and humorous stories to remember their loved one's joyous moments. 


Another prevalent myth is that embalming is a mandatory part of the funeral process. In reality, embalming is only required in certain situations, such as when the body needs to be preserved for an extended period before burial or if public health concerns exist. Families can choose alternative methods like refrigeration or immediate burial, which can be more eco-friendly and practical. 


Funeral expenses are a significant concern for many families, and the myth that funerals must be extravagant and expensive can add to the stress of the grieving process. However, there are numerous affordable options available. From direct cremation to simple memorial services, families can choose arrangements that fit their budget while still paying tribute to their loved one. 


Cremation is becoming increasingly popular, yet some believe it is an irreversible process that eliminates the possibility of a traditional burial. This is not the case. After cremation, families can keep the cremain in an urn, spread them in a meaningful location, or even have a small burial ceremony. Cremation offers flexibility and allows for various memorialization options. 


Many people assume that hiring a funeral director is obligatory but entirely optional. Families can plan and conduct a funeral service themselves if they wish. While funeral directors provide valuable expertise and support, families can take a more hands-on approach, involving friends and family members in the planning and execution of the service


The grieving process is unique to each individual, and there is no set timeline for how long it should take. Some people may feel a sense of closure soon after a funeral, while others may continue to experience grief for an extended period. Acknowledging and respecting each person's grieving process is essential, offering support and understanding as needed.
